FAQs for deck, fence, patio or porch clean and seal projects in Nocatee, FL

You should clean your deck before sealing it. Cleaning before refinishing is critical. If you don’t remove dirt and debris, you'll trap moisture in the wood, which prevents the new sealer from working correctly and can lead to costly repairs. Whether you need to sand, power wash, or sandblast depends on your deck's condition.

Sealing and staining your deck are essential maintenance methods that protect and beautify your outdoor space. Stain adds rich color and guards against fading, while sealant fortifies the wood against moisture and weather damage. Wood type, climate, deck age, and the degree of existing damage determine whether your deck benefits from one or both treatments. Using both options extends your deck’s durability and enhances its overall appearance.

Power washing and sealing your deck costs $500 to $1,700. This process combines the removal of stubborn dirt and debris with a protective seal that preserves the wood’s integrity. Effective cleaning eliminates harmful buildup, and a proper seal prevents moisture damage and wood decay, ensuring long-term durability and reducing future repair expenses.

Your deck must be sealed every one to three years to maintain its strength and appearance. Regular sealing is essential to protect the wood against moisture, mold, and harmful UV rays. A consistent sealing schedule prevents rapid deterioration and costly repairs. Inspections should be performed annually to determine if the protective layer remains intact, extending the life of your deck.

Leaving your deck untreated compromises its structural integrity and safety. An unprotected deck rots quickly due to moisture and environmental exposure, which means that neglecting sealing results in rapid decay and expensive replacement costs of $4,125 to $11,650. Sealing your deck is essential for maintaining its durability and protecting your home.

The sealant on your deck dries within a few hours and reaches full cure within 72 hours before regular use. It is essential to wait until the complete curing period to ensure the protective layer fully sets and resists weather and foot traffic. Proper drying guarantees that your deck is fully protected against moisture and environmental damage, ensuring lasting quality.
